Put flatware in the removable basket with handles up
to protect your hands. Mix knives, forks and spoons
so they don't nest together. Distribute evenly.
Be sure handles do not touch upper rack. For best
washing results be sure not to load large plates and
cookware between silverware basket and the center
of the rack.
The lower rack is best used for plates, saucers, and
cookware. Large items such as broiler pans and racks
should go in the lower rack along the edge. Load
platters, pots and bowls along the sides, in corners, or
in the back. For best washing results, all items should
be positioned with the soile~ side facing the center of
the rack.
